Common HVAC issues in Gotha homes and businesses
Residents and business owners in Gotha typically call for service for these problems:
- AC runs but does not cool: often caused by low refrigerant, compressor issues, or airflow restrictions.
- Frequent short-cycling: electrical issues, improper sizing, or thermostat miscalibration.
- Frozen evaporator coils or clogged condensate drains: higher humidity and poor airflow.
- Uneven cooling or hot rooms: duct leaks, poor insulation, or imbalanced systems.
- Strange noises or electrical trips: failing capacitors, motors, or loose components.
- Emergency failures during heat waves or after storms: storm-related power surges and debris can damage outdoor units.

Maintenance tips for Gotha homeowners and businesses
- Replace or clean filters every 1-3 months during heavy-use seasons.
- Schedule preventive maintenance before the hottest months to ensure peak performance.
- Keep outdoor units clear of debris and overgrowth, especially during storm season.
- Monitor humidity and use dehumidification when needed to reduce mold risks.
- Seal and insulate ducts where accessible to improve efficiency and room-to-room comfort.
